Element Selection Criteria Appendix 1 Overview Elements in Abaqus Structural Elements (Shells and Beams) vs. Continuum Elements Modeling Bending Using Continuum Elements Stress Concentrations Contact Incompressible Materials Mesh Generation Solid Element Selection Summary Elements in Abaqus Elements in Abaqus The wide range of elements in the Abaqus element library provides flexibility in modeling different geometries and structures. Each element can be characterized by considering the following: Family Number of nodes Degrees of freedom Formulation Integration Elements in Abaqus Family A family of finite elements is the broadest category used to classify elements. Elements in the same family share many basic features. There are many variations within a family. Elements in Abaqus Number of nodes (interpolation) An element’s number of nodes determines how the nodal degrees of freedom will be interpolated over the domain of the element. Abaqus includes elements with both first- and second-order interpolation. Elements in Abaqus Degrees of freedom The primary variables that exist at the nodes of an element are the degrees of freedom in the finite element analysis. Examples of degrees of freedom are: Displacements Rotations Temperature Electrical potential Some elements have internal degrees of freedom that are not associated with the user-defined nodes. Elements in Abaqus Formulation The mathematical formulation used to describe the behavior of an element is another broad category that is used to classify elements. Examples of different element formulations: Elements in Abaqus Integration The stiffness and mass of an element are calculated numerically at sampling points called “integration points” within the element. The numerical algorithm used to integrate these variables influences how an element behaves. Elements in Abaqus Abaqus includes elements with both “full” and “reduced” integration.
